Keeping an inventory of your household belongings can be extremely beneficial. A detailed inventory can support insurance policy updates and make the claims process much easier if your property is damaged or stolen. Understanding how an inventory helps and knowing how to create one can save time and reduce stress.
How an Inventory Supports Insurance Coverage
A household inventory is a detailed list of personal belongings kept in your home. Creating an inventory involves documenting items of value that may need to be covered under your home insurance policy.
Having an inventory allows you to clearly communicate your coverage needs when purchasing or updating an insurance policy. It helps ensure that valuable belongings are properly accounted for and adequately insured.
An inventory is also especially helpful during the claims process. If items are damaged, stolen, or destroyed due to a covered event, your inventory can help you determine what was lost and support the documentation required for a claim.
Guidelines for Creating an Inventory
When compiling your inventory, focus on items that have significant monetary or sentimental value. These are the belongings you would most want to repair or replace if they were damaged, stolen, or vandalized.
Smaller items that are easily replaceable may not need to be included. For each listed item, record details such as the model number, approximate value, and any other relevant information that may be required by your insurance provider.
Your inventory should be updated regularly. If you sell, donate, or dispose of items, be sure to revise your list so it accurately reflects your current belongings.
